Year one was, of course, a learning curve. A very steep learning curve some times. There were quite a few design issues that caused problems for some guests - someone couldn’t sleep with the low green light from the router that was hidden under the cupboard, another guest wanted more room for ‘stuff’ on the bedside table, someone forgot to close the velux windows (problematic when it rains) and on and on However, the snags were all noted down and when we closed for January, in came Richie and his tools to sort everything out.
We had the wow factor in the main room but the bathroom just wasn’t up to scratch and there was something definitely missing in the bedroom as they say. By the middle of February, we should have sorted out most of the known snags and given both bedroom and bathroom something of a facelift.

You may be wondering why we call it the Pijjery? It all stems from our daughter aka ‘the naughty Pixie’ who, once upon a time many years ago, decided to change G’s for J’s. So when we found the old pig doors in the building we assumed once upon a time this was home to grunty, snuffly pink pigs and thus a Piggery. Factor in the Naughty Pixie’s interpretation and ‘the Pijjery’ was born!
